Crafting a White Paper in the Crypto World: A Comprehensive Guide

In the rapidly evolving crypto industry, a white paper serves as a crucial document that outlines the fundamentals of a new cryptocurrency project. It serves as a bridge between the developers and potential investors, providing essential information about the project's purpose, technology, and potential for growth. Crafting a compelling white paper can make or break a project's success. This article delves into the intricacies of writing a white paper in the crypto domain, offering practical tips and insights.

1. Understand the purpose of a white paper

A white paper is not just a marketing document; it is a comprehensive guide that outlines the details of a new cryptocurrency project. It is crucial to understand that a white paper is meant to educate potential investors, developers, and the general public about the project's goals, technology, and potential impact. A well-written white paper can help in building trust and credibility among stakeholders.

2. Conduct thorough research

Before writing a white paper, it is essential to conduct thorough research on the following aspects:

a. The problem that the cryptocurrency project aims to solve

b. The existing solutions and their limitations

c. The technology behind the cryptocurrency, including blockchain, smart contracts, and any unique features

d. The team behind the project, including their expertise and experience

e. The roadmap and future plans for the project

3. Structure your white paper effectively

A well-structured white paper is easier to read and understand. Here is a suggested structure:

a. Choose a concise and catchy title that reflects the essence of your project.

b. Introduction: Briefly introduce the project, its purpose, and the problem it aims to solve.

c. Problem statement: Clearly define the problem that your project intends to address.

d. Solution: Explain how your cryptocurrency project offers a unique solution to the identified problem.

e. Technology: Describe the technology behind your project, including blockchain, smart contracts, and any unique features.

f. Team: Introduce the team members, highlighting their expertise and experience in the crypto industry.

g. Roadmap: Outline the timeline and milestones for your project, including the development, testing, and launch phases.

h. Tokenomics: Explain the token distribution, use cases, and potential future developments.

i. Conclusion: Summarize the key points and emphasize the potential of your project.

j. References: Cite all the sources and external references used in your white paper.

4. Write in clear and concise language

Ensure that your white paper is written in clear, concise, and jargon-free language. Avoid technical jargon that might confuse readers, especially those who are new to the crypto industry. Use simple language to explain complex concepts, and provide examples where necessary.

5. Visual elements and formatting

Incorporate visual elements such as charts, graphs, and images to make your white paper more engaging and easier to understand. Ensure that the formatting is consistent throughout the document, with appropriate headings, subheadings, and font sizes.

6. Proofread and edit

Before finalizing your white paper, proofread and edit it to ensure there are no grammatical errors, typos, or inconsistencies. A well-polished white paper reflects positively on your project and enhances its credibility.

7. Get feedback and iterate

Seek feedback from friends, colleagues, and experts in the crypto industry. Incorporate their suggestions and iterate on your white paper to make it more compelling and informative.

8. Publish and distribute

Once your white paper is complete, publish it on your project's website and share it across social media platforms, forums, and crypto communities. Ensure that the document is accessible to anyone interested in your project.

9. Maintain transparency and communication

As your project progresses, maintain transparency and communication with stakeholders. Update your white paper as needed to reflect the latest developments and milestones.

10. Monitor the reception and make improvements

Observe the reception of your white paper and gather feedback from readers. Use this information to make improvements and refine your document for future iterations.

In conclusion, writing a white paper in the crypto world requires thorough research, clear communication, and a well-structured document. By following these tips, you can create a compelling white paper that educates and convinces potential investors, developers, and the general public about the potential of your cryptocurrency project.
